Synopsis: Engineers will benefit from this book because it blends the theoretical aspects of simulations with a simulation package so they can put the concepts to practice. It utilizes the Arena Simulation Environment as the primary modeling tool for simulation. More detailed discussions of the statistical aspects of simulation are presented than are found in many other simulation language oriented textbooks. Special emphasis is placed on the computer programming aspects of simulation. The accompanying CD-ROM also contains the student version of Arena along with illustrations, solutions to several exercises, and additional files. With the help of numerous hands-on exercises and engaging material, engineers will learn how to apply the concepts to real-world situations. From the Back Cover: This introduction to discrete-event simulation modeling and analysis provides detailed discussions of the statistical aspects of simulation along with the traditional examination of simulation language. Merging the two most common approaches to the subject, and adding a special emphasis on the art of model building, Simulation Modeling and Arena helps you build a solid foundation in the theoretical aspects of simulations while developing practical expertise in the art of model building. Key features include: Learning Objectives for each chaper Statistical output analysis integrated with Arena Emphasis on activity based learning Builds on computer programming experience Language-independent conceptual modeling process Coverage of classic stochastic models from operations research Comprehensive examples and exercises Arena software bundled with the text with all example files
